METHOD FOR DERIVING RESERVOIR LITHOLOGY AND FLUID CONTENT FROM PRE-STACK INVERSION OF SEISMIC DATA

A method for deriving reservoir lithology andfluid content for a target location (400) from pre-stack seismic reflection data (110). The method usesinversion (200) of pre-stack seismic reflection datafor both the target location and a calibration location(110) having known subsurface lithology and fluidcontent to derive the subsurface lithology and fluidcontent at the target location (400). The inversionprocess (200) is preferably a viscoelastic inversionto account for the effects of friction on seismic wavepropagation. The results of the inversion process area set of subsurface elastic parameters for both thetarget and calibration locations. Relative magnitudesof these subsurface elastic parameters are compared(300), together with the known subsurface lithologyand fluid content at the calibration location (146), toderive the subsurface lithology and fluid content atthe target location (400).
